Job Description Summary
The Director - Strategy is the analytical engine behind the Strategy function, supporting high-impact initiatives across the enterprise. This role is ideal for a former consultant from a top-tier firm who thrives on solving complex problems, synthesizing data, and building compelling strategic narratives. The role is highly hands-on, with significant exposure to senior leadership and cross-functional teams. Ideal candidate will need to demonstrate independent project management and problem solving skills, as well as leadership management experience so they can own large, high-impact projects end to end.

Job Description

Key Responsibilities

Analytical Execution
  • Conduct deep-dive analyses on market trends, competitive dynamics, and internal performance metrics.
  • Build financial models, dashboards, and scenario analyses to support strategic decision-making.
  • Translate complex data into clear insights and recommendations.


Research & Insight Generation
  • Perform primary and secondary research on industry trends, emerging technologies, and regulatory shifts.
  • Benchmark competitors and identify whitespace opportunities.
  • Market assessments and scenarios.
  • Stay current on MedTech innovation, M&A activity, and policy developments.


Strategic Storytelling
  • Create executive-level presentations, strategy pages, and briefing materials.
  • Support the VP of Strategy in preparing for internal strategy reviews.
  • Ensure clarity, logic, and impact in all deliverables.


Project Leadership
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ams (Commercial, Finance, R&D, Operations) to gather inputs and validate assumptions.
  • Lead Project from initiation, tracking progress and flagging risks or bottlenecks.
  • Help manage project timelines, deliverables, and stakeholder communications.

About General Electric Company

GE Healthcare provides medical technology, intelligent devices, and care solutions. They offer medical imaging, information technologies, medical diagnostics, patient monitoring systems, performance improvement, drug discovery, and biopharmaceutical manufacturing technologies. GE Healthcare's mission is to improve patient care and outcomes by providing innovative healthcare solutions. Their technologies are used in hospitals, clinics, research institutions, and pharmaceutical companies worldwide to diagnose and treat various medical conditions.
